Percentages are based on the idea of dividing a whole into one hundred equal parts. This simple structure allows people to understand relationships between numbers quickly. Whether someone is calculating exam scores, business profits, or shopping discounts, percentages provide instant context. Accuracy ensures that this context remains meaningful and trustworthy.

Business and finance are areas where accuracy is especially critical. Profit margins, growth rates, interest calculations, and tax values are often expressed as percentages. Even a small mistake can lead to financial loss or incorrect reporting. Professionals need reliable calculations to plan budgets, evaluate performance, and communicate results clearly to stakeholders.

Technology has made percentage calculations faster and more accessible. Digital tools allow users to input values and receive results instantly. This convenience saves time and reduces the chance of manual arithmetic errors. However, accuracy still depends on correct inputs and a basic understanding of what the result represents. Tools are most effective when users know how to interpret the outcome.
